Posted Feb 17 Zoom is in search of a Team Lead for its Prevention & Recovery team (PnR) which is a critical part of Zoom’s Trust and Safety (T&S) team. T&S handles fraud, complaints of abuse on the platform (such as meeting disruptions), responds to law enforcement requests from around the globe, carries out part of Zoom’s export control program, and is building Zoom’s arsenal of tools to combat abuse both before and after it happens.
PnR is the operational linchpin of the T&S team. We respond to and investigate user reports of abuse, we help develop new proactive tools to prevent abuse from happening on Zoom, and we work cross-functionally to create products that are safe-by-design. The PnR team is creative and collaborative. We work closely with anyone at Zoom who has identified potential abuse, from billing, to support, to legal and communications. We have dedicated engineering and data science resources and access to any internal tool we need to carry out our mission. We also work with external partners, for example when a particular kind of abuse involves other tech platforms. We are committed to ensuring transparency, consistency, and adhering to compliance regulations.
